Common Issues with Bifold Doors
Bifold doors can face a series of problems, especially if they are utilized regularly or not preserved appropriately. Below is a table summarizing a few of the normal issues, their causes, and corresponding options.
| Concern | Possible Causes | Solutions |
|---|---|---|
| Trouble Opening/Closing | Dirty tracks, misalignment, damaged rollers | Clean tracks, straighten doors, replace rollers |
| Space Between Door Panels | Unequal floor, settling foundation | Adjust hinges, shim the door frame |
| Doors Sticking | Debris buildup, humidity-induced swelling | Tidy and lube tracks, allow doors to acclimate |
| Noise During Operation | Used rollers, dirt, absence of lubrication | Lube hinges and rollers, replace if required |
| Misaligned Panels | Inappropriate setup, wear and tear | Adjust hinges, seek advice from a professional if needed |
| Warping | Severe temperature level variations, moisture | Replace distorted doors, use sealant to avoid moisture |
Inspecting Bifold Doors: A Step-By-Step Guide
Before diving into solutions, it's essential to evaluate and understand the specific concerns with your bifold doors. Here's an in-depth approach to troubleshooting:
Check the Tracks:
- What to Look For: Dirt, particles, or use and tear.
- How to Fix: Use a vacuum or damp fabric to clear out the tracks completely. Afterwards, use a silicone-based lube to ensure smooth operation.
Examine the Rollers:
- What to Look For: Signs of damage or wear.
- How to Fix: If the rollers are harmed, replace them. A lot of bifold doors have adjustable rollers that can be adjusted to ensure a much better fit.
Take a look at Alignment:
- What to Look For: Doors not sitting flush or sensation stuck.
- How to Fix: Check and adjust the hinges and ensure that the door panels are level. You may need a level to assist in this procedure.
Check the Hinges:
- What to Look For: Looseness or rust.
- How to Fix: Tighten loose screws and lube hinges. If rust is present, consider replacing the hinge.
Assess the Door Frame:
- What to Look For: Gaps or warping in the frame.
- How to Fix: Adjust the door frame by shimming as required to guarantee that the doors close appropriately.
Test for Swelling:
- What to Look For: Signs of wetness damage, especially in wooden doors.
- How to Fix: If wetness is the problem, consider using a sealant or changing the panel with a more moisture-resistant material.
Routine Maintenance Tips for Bifold Doors
Preventative maintenance can assist guarantee the longevity of bifold doors. Here are some vital tips to keep your bifold doors in top condition:
- Monthly Cleaning: Keep the tracks clean to avoid dirt buildup.
- Regular Lubrication: Every couple of months, oil the hinges and rollers to preserve smooth operation.
- Routine Inspections: Check for indications of wear and tear, especially after extreme weather condition.
- Changes: Keep hinges and rollers adapted to make sure proper positioning and effectiveness.
